Transaction ff37581533b6c8e404aa36398d9caf08cca0896ec79d8ebbf7cba9661214b047
1 Input
1 Output
-
ff37581533b6c8e404aa36398d9caf08cca0896ec79d8ebbf7cba9661214b047:0
- value
- 6074492
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02f7b3f7751cebf85e0b4c55af327b6bb2252bb4 OP_EQUAL
- address
- 31xi1dgMwCZpmCRasSrshrjkcLBpurok1M